Troubleshooting Subtitle Display
If you are experiencing issues with subtitle display on your Philips TV, troubleshooting the problem can help you enjoy uninterrupted viewing of your favorite content. Firstly, ensure that the subtitle file format is compatible with your TV. Philips TVs typically support commonly used subtitle formats like SRT, SUB, and SMI. If the subtitle files are in a different format, consider converting them to a compatible format using online tools or software.
Secondly, check the settings on your TV to confirm that subtitles are enabled. Navigate to the Accessibility or Subtitle settings on your Philips TV and make sure the subtitle option is turned on. If subtitles are enabled but still not displaying, try adjusting the subtitle settings such as font size, color, and position to see if it resolves the issue. Additionally, verifying that the subtitle file and the video file are stored in the same directory and have corresponding names can also help in troubleshooting display problems.
By following these troubleshooting steps, you can efficiently address subtitle display issues on your Philips TV and enhance your overall viewing experience. If problems persist after attempting these solutions, consider reaching out to Philips customer support for further assistance.
Using External Subtitle Files
Using external subtitle files is a convenient way to enhance your viewing experience on a Philips TV. These subtitle files can be easily downloaded from various online sources or created by users themselves. Common subtitle file formats include SRT, ASS, and SUB, which are compatible with most Philips TV models.
To use external subtitle files, simply save the file with the exact same filename as the video file you are watching. Ensure that both files are stored in the same folder on your USB drive or external storage device. When playing the video on your Philips TV, the subtitles should automatically load and synchronize with the content.
If the subtitles do not appear or sync correctly, you can adjust the subtitle settings on your Philips TV to customize the font size, color, and position to suit your preferences. Additionally, make sure that the subtitle encoding matches the language of the subtitles for seamless integration with your viewing experience.

How Can I Access The Subtitle Settings On My Philips Tv?
To access subtitle settings on your Philips TV, start by pressing the “Home” button on your remote control. Navigate to the “Settings” menu using the arrow keys and select “Picture.” From there, scroll down to “Subtitles” and press “OK” to enter the subtitle settings. Adjust the subtitle language, size, style, and other settings as needed. If you’re unable to find the subtitle settings following these steps, refer to your TV’s user manual for specific instructions tailored to your model.
